The exterior facade of a residential property in South Philadelphia, Manayunk, or Roxborough is subjected to relentless environmental assault. From freezing winter sleet to intense summer ultraviolet radiation and urban atmospheric pollution, exterior building materials expand, contract, and degrade over time. When paint begins to blister, flake away from window trim, or chalk across masonry surfaces, property owners often schedule an immediate repainting project. However, paint is purely a protective and decorative finish coating; it is not a structural adhesive or a waterproof building membrane. Applying fresh paint over decayed wood, unsealed joints, or active moisture leaks guarantees premature coating failure within months. A lasting exterior paint job relies entirely on identifying and correcting underlying building envelope defects before a paintbrush is lifted.
Identifying Exterior Surface Defects That Require Correction
A thorough physical audit of your property’s exterior skin must precede any coating application. Professional painters inspect wood, masonry, and architectural trim for specific symptoms of material failure:
- Peeling, Blistering, and Alligatoring Paint: Coatings that separate from the substrate in flaking sheets or form bubbling pockets indicate that moisture is trapped behind the paint film, or that original primers have lost their chemical bond.
- Chalking and Oxidation: A fine, powdery white residue wiping off exterior surfaces confirms that the existing paint binder has broken down from UV solar exposure. Painting directly over heavy chalk prevents new coatings from adhering, requiring deep cleaning and specialized bonding primers.
- Failed Perimeter Sealants: The elastomeric caulking joints where window frames meet brick masonry, where siding butt-joints intersect, or where architectural trim boards abut exterior walls eventually dry out, shrink, and split open, allowing wind-driven rain to penetrate the wall cavity.
- Exposed and Weathered Timber: Bare wood cornices, window sills, and fascia boards stripped of protective paint quickly turn gray as solar radiation degrades the wood cellulose, leaving the timber fibrous and susceptible to rot.
Correcting Connected Building Envelope Failures
Before cosmetic surface preparation begins, active moisture infiltration from surrounding architectural systems must be resolved. Paint will not adhere to a substrate that is continually wetted from behind. Property owners must ensure that overflowing roof gutters are cleared or re-pitched, roof flashing transitions around chimneys and skylights are watertight, and failing masonry mortar joints along brick parapets are repointed. If exterior wood trim, window sills, or porch columns exhibit soft, spongy dry rot, the compromised timber must be physically excised and replaced with sound wood or durable cellular PVC composites. Applying paint over rotting wood simply traps moisture within the timber, accelerating structural decay out of sight.
Rigorous Surface Preparation: The Foundation of Adhesion
Once building envelope leaks and carpentry repairs are completed, professional exterior painters execute a multi-step surface preparation methodology:
- Low-Pressure Washing and Decontamination: The exterior is washed using controlled, low-pressure water and specialized detergents to remove accumulated urban grime, exhaust soot, mildew, and loose surface chalk without gouging historical wood trim or driving pressurized water behind siding panels.
- Scraping and Feather-Sanding: All loose, flaking, and blistered paint must be removed down to a sound, tightly adhered substrate. Professional painters hand-scrape failing areas and mechanically sand the sharp, step-like edges of remaining paint patches—a process known as feathering—to create a smooth, tactile transition that prevents old paint lines from telescoping through the new finish.
- Perimeter Joint Sealing: All exterior joints, nail holes, and linear gaps between trim and cladding are cleared of old caulk and resealed using premium, architectural-grade exterior polyurethane or elastomeric acrylic sealants that stretch with building movement.
- Targeted Substrate Priming: Bare, exposed wood must be coated with high-penetration exterior oil-based or acrylic bonding primers that seal wood grain, block tannin bleeding, and provide an uniform gripping surface for topcoats.
Weather Conditions and Coating Science
The durability of an exterior paint finish is heavily influenced by environmental conditions during application and curing. Professional painters monitor ambient air temperature, surface substrate temperature, and relative humidity. Adhering to National Weather Service environmental humidity guidance, painting should never occur during rain events, when atmospheric condensation is heavy, or when surface temperatures exceed coating manufacturer tolerances under direct summer sunlight. Direct solar baking can cause latex paint to dry too rapidly on the surface before the acrylic binders can properly coalesce, leading to poor film adhesion and early blistering.

Why is paint peeling off my exterior window sills and wood trim? Peeling paint on horizontal window sills and trim is typically caused by bulk rainwater or melting snow sitting on flat surfaces, moisture vapor migrating out from inside the home, or painting over bare wood that wasn’t properly primed and sealed.
Can I just paint over cracked or peeling exterior paint to protect the wood? No. Painting over loose, flaking, or blistered paint will fail rapidly. The new paint attaches only to the failing old coat beneath it; as the old paint continues to pull away from the wood, the brand-new topcoat will peel off right along with it.
Why is it important to wash an exterior house before repainting? Urban exteriors accumulate atmospheric soot, dirt, mildew, and degraded paint chalk. Washing the property removes these bond-breaking contaminants, ensuring that new primers and paints adhere directly to the sound building material beneath.
What type of caulk should be used around exterior windows and trim before painting? Professional exterior painting requires high-performance, architectural-grade polyurethane or elastomeric acrylic-latex sealants. These specialized caulks remain highly flexible over a wide temperature range, stretching with building movement without cracking or pulling away.
Why do exterior painters stop working during extremely hot, sunny summer afternoons? Painting in direct, blistering sunlight heats the building substrate excessively. When paint hits a surface over 90 to 100 degrees Fahrenheit, the water or solvent evaporates too fast, preventing the chemical binders from fusing properly and causing early adhesion failure.
